What is the standard procedure for criminal background checks in Mexico?
The standard procedure for criminal background checks in Mexico involves obtaining the candidate's consent, collecting personal information, requesting criminal records from the relevant authorities, and reviewing the results. It is essential to comply with data protection regulations during this process and ensure the confidentiality of the information.
What is the legislation that regulates the crime of exposing minors to danger in Guatemala?
In Guatemala, the crime of exposing minors to danger is regulated by the Penal Code and the Law for the Comprehensive Protection of Children and Adolescents. These laws establish sanctions for those who put the life or integrity of minors at risk by exposing them to dangerous, negligent situations or that affect their physical, mental or emotional development. The legislation seeks to protect children and ensure a safe and healthy environment for their growth.
What should I do if my DUI contains incorrect information on my filing status and I need to correct it?
If your DUI contains incorrect information in your marital status, you must file a correction request with the RNPN and provide legal documents supporting the change, such as a divorce decree or an updated marriage certificate.
